London-Based ‘Hamas Operative’ Behind Greta Thunberg’s Gaza Flotilla

A man accused of being “a Hamas operative” based in London is a key figure behind Greta Thunberg’s Gaza aid boat, it has emerged. The Telegraph has the story.

Zaher Birawi, who was described in Parliament as a person with links to Hamas, called himself a “founding member” of the Freedom Flotilla International Coalition, which arranged the voyage by the aid boat Madleen.

Israeli forces boarded and seized the boat on Sunday, detaining the 12 pro-Palestinian activists it was carrying, including Ms Thunberg, as it attempted to bring a “symbolic” amount of aid to Gaza in defiance of an Israeli naval blockade.

Mr Birawi, a Palestinian-British journalist at an Arabic-language satellite TV channel in London, was at the launch of the Madleen a week ago, livestreaming it from its dock in Sicily. Ms Thunberg gave a speech before the boat set sail for Gaza.

In 2013, Mr Birawi was named by Israel as a Hamas operative in Europe, and is the head of the Europal Forum, which Israel designated as a terrorist organisation in 2021.

The Europal Forum has strongly denied any terror links, and in 2021 Mr Birwani received compensation after taking legal action against a financial database he said had wrongly placed him on a terrorism watch list. 

He denied ever being involved in any illegal acts within the scope of terrorism crimes.

Speaking in the Commons in October 2023, Christian Wakeford, the Labour MP for Bury South, used Parliamentary privilege to name 63 year-old Mr Birawi as a Hamas operative living in Barnet, north London.

“He is listed as a trustee of a UK-registered charity, Education Aid for Palestinians, and publicly available video shows him hosting a 2019 event in London titled Understanding Hamas,” Mr Wakeford told MPs.

“Two weeks ago, Hamas launched the deadliest terror attack [the October 7th attack on Israel] the world has seen since 9/11. It is therefore a serious national security risk for Hamas operatives to be living here in London, especially where at least one appears to have done so through the use of fake documents in obtaining British citizenship.”

There is no suggestion that Mr Birwani was involved in the October 7th attack.

Hamas has been proscribed as a terror group in the UK under the Terrorism Act 2000 since 2021.

Meanwhile it’s reported that Greta and chums – whose boat was sprayed with a white irritant ahead of being seized – will be forced to watch a video of Hamas’s October 7th atrocities – and Sweden has refused to get involved. From the Mail:

Sweden has rejected Greta Thunberg’s plea for help on board the ‘freedom flotilla’ after Israeli commandos intercepted the vessel on its approach to Gaza.

Maria Malmer Stenergard, the Swedish Minister of Foreign Affairs, said on Monday that she believes Thunberg is not in need of support from the Ministry after the climate activist called on followers to pressure the Government into action.

“A great responsibility rests on those who choose to travel contrary to the advice given to a place,” she said, as protesters gathered in Stockholm to demand an intervention. …

The Freedom Flotilla Coalition (FFC), which organised the voyage from Italy to raise awareness of the humanitarian crisis in Gaza, said last night that the ship had come “under assault” in the Mediterranean Sea.

The Madleen was said to have been shadowed by speedboats and drones before ‘quadcopters’ surrounded and sprayed the ship with an unidentified “white irritant substance”, shortly before the IDF seized it.

Images showed the deck splattered with white liquid. Activist Yasmin Acar, among those on board, said it had been deployed by Israel and was affecting her eyes.
